Most Italians use grain alcohol and we've never had a problem with using it. Make sure you use at least ten lemons per liter. Also, don't heat the lemon-alcohol mixture. Make the simple syrup when you are finished steeping the peel (2 weeks approx) and after it cools, mix w/the strained liquor. What Is the Best Way to Make Limoncello? Good Questions |

Are you boiling the milk on the stove? The one time I attempted to microwave the milk prior to incubation it came out really runny. Otherwise, boiling it first has resulted in quite firm 2% yogurt in my Euro Cuisine maker. I started it w/whole milk Fage Greek yogurt and have just been using my own yogurt as a starter since. How Can I Make Thicker Homemade Yogurt? Good Questions | Apartment Therapy The Kitchn |
